Object history |
1901: Ambroise Vollard (art dealer), Paris 1901: purchased by Henry Osborne Havemeyer (1847-1907), New York City, from Ambroise Vollard, Paris 1907: inherited by Louisine Havemeyer (1855-1929), New York |
